Public Transit
Start at the Federal Way Transit Center. Board the Sound Transit Express Bus 586 towards Auburn. The bus will take you directly towards Auburn. After approximately 20 minutes, disembark at the Auburn Station. From there, transfer to Pierce Transit Bus 496 towards Auburn Valley. Ride for about 10 minutes. Get off at the 'Western St NW & 4th St NW' stop. Walk north on Western St NW for about 5 minutes until you reach Auburn Environmental Park, located at 413 Western St NW, Auburn, WA 98001.
Walking
If you are near the Auburn Station, head north on 4th St NW for about 0.4 miles. Once you reach Western St NW, turn left and walk west for about 0.2 miles. You will find Auburn Environmental Park on your right at 413 Western St NW, Auburn, WA 98001.
Biking
From the Federal Way area, you can bike to Auburn Environmental Park. Follow the Interurban Trail heading south towards Auburn. Once you reach Auburn, follow the trail until it connects to Western St NW. Turn right onto Western St NW and continue for about 0.5 miles. The park will be on your left at 413 Western St NW, Auburn, WA 98001.
